These are the official results of the Men's Hammer Throw event at the 1991 World Championships in Tokyo, Japan. There were a total number of 27 participating athletes, with the final held on Sunday August 25, 1991. The qualification mark was set at 75.50 metres.

Medalists

Gold Flag of the Soviet Union.svg Yuriy Sedykh
Soviet Union (URS)
Silver Flag of the Soviet Union.svg Igor Astapkovich
Soviet Union (URS)
Bronze Flag of Germany.svg Heinz Weis
Germany (GER)
